高效Unix开发环境构建速成指南

在Unix系统上构建高效开发环境,关键在于合理选择工具和配置。推荐使用Bash或Zsh作为默认shell,它们提供了强大的命令行功能和脚本支持。

安装必要的开发工具链是基础步骤。包括GCC、Make、GDB等编译工具,以及Git用于版本控制。可以通过包管理器如apt、brew或yum快速安装这些工具。

AI绘图结果,仅供参考

配置环境变量可以显著提升工作效率。将常用命令路径添加到PATH中,设置编辑器和终端的别名,能减少重复输入,提高操作速度。

使用文本编辑器或IDE时,选择支持Unix风格的工具很重要。Vim、Emacs或VS Code都是不错的选择,它们支持插件扩展,可适配多种开发需求。

自动化脚本是Unix开发的核心之一。通过编写Shell脚本或使用Makefile,可以简化编译、测试和部署流程,减少人为错误。

定期清理和维护系统,避免依赖冲突和性能下降。使用工具如apt-get clean或brew cleanup保持系统整洁。

掌握基本的Unix命令和文件权限管理,有助于更安全地进行开发工作。了解chmod、chown和ls等命令的使用场景,能有效避免常见问题。

dawei

【声明】:南充站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复